Chinese porcelain vase, decorated with a scene of scholars seated in a garden in famille rose enamels. With a six-character Daoguang seal mark along the underside in red enamels, partially obscured by a drill hole. The vase has been mounted as a lamp.

From the collection of Katherine Walker Griffith, a descendant of T.B. Walker, founder of The Walker Art Center in Minneapolis, Minnesota, and a renowned collector of Chinese porcelain.

Height: 29 1/4 in x diameter: 6 1/2 in.

Condition

Other than the hole drilled in the bottom, vase is in very good condition with no chips, cracks, or restorations. There is very little wear to the enamels.
